File: //usr/lib/python3/dist-packages/hgext/convert/__pycache__/hg.cpython-310.pyc
o
�]Lb�b � @ s� d dl mZ d dlZd dlZd dlZd dlmZ d dlmZ d dl m
Z
mZmZ d dl
mZmZmZmZmZmZmZmZmZmZmZmZ d dlmZ ejZdd lm Z e j!Z!e j"Z"e�#d
�Z$G dd� de j%�Z&G d
d� de j'�Z(dS )� )�absolute_importN)�_)�open)�bin�hex�sha1nodeconstants)� bookmarks�context�error�exchange�hg�lock�
logcmdutil�merge�
mergestate�phases�pycompat�util)�dateutil� )�commons \b[0-9a-f]{12,40}\bc @ s� e Zd Zdd� Zdd� Zdd� Zdd� Zd d
� Zdd� Zd
d� Z dd� Z
dd� Zdd� Zdd� Z
dd� Zdd� Zdd� Zdd� ZdS ) �mercurial_sinkc
C sV t j�| |||� |�dd�| _|�dd�| _|�dd�| _d | _t j
�|�r`tt �
|��dkr`zt�| j|�| _| j�� sFttd�| ��W nU tjy_ } z|�� t|jd ��d }~ww z(|�td�| � tj| j|dd �| _| j�� s�ttd�| ��| j�|� W n tjy� |�� ttd
�| ��w d | _d | _d| _i | _d S )N� converts hg.usebranchnamess hg.clonebranchess
hg.tagsbranchr �&